Product Description

Meet the fabulous X-Men: Cyclops, who shoots concentrated beams of energy... Colossus, impervious to harm... the Dazzler, transforming the sun into powerful bolts of light... Nightcrawler, with unique powers of teleportation... Wolverine, whose razor-like claws can slice through any substance known to man... Storm, who can control weather itself... and their leader, Professor X, who has the ability to see into people's minds. All these mutant powers! Will they be enough to crush the tremendous villainy of the evil Magneto and his henchman... the Blob, Pyro, and the Juggernaut??

5.0 out of 5 stars Pryde of the X-Men is X-citing!, June 18, 2002
By Peter Saenz "Artemisboy" (Los Angeles, CA United States) - See all my reviews
(REAL NAME)   
Made in 1989, Marvel comics decided to give it's most profitable comic book (X-Men) the animation treatment. In Pryde of the X-Men, Marvel took the 'Wizard of Oz Approach' to storytelling as we see a new-comer to the X-Ranks in the character Kitty Pryde. Kitty is born a mutant who finds she can walk through walls. Scared and confused by her mutantcy, Kitty is sent a letter to attend the Xavier Institute to learn how to control her mutant abilities. It is here that she (and we) are introduced to the X-Men. A group of persons who share a similar past. Like Kitty, they too were born with wonderous powers. The welcome is short lived though as the evil Magneto breaks into the X-Mansion where the X-Men live and steals a powerful computer circuit. The X-Men and Kitty Pryde must find out why and stop Magneto's terrible scheme. Made with an animation style that mirrored successful cartoons such as G.I. Joe and Thundercats, Pryde of the X-Men had a great visually appealing look. Although this was the only episode made, audiences were not to wait too long for more adventures from the merry mutants. In 1992 and 2000 the X-Men were re-introduced to new generations of fans. I highly recommend this adventurous video.

5.0 out of 5 stars Base your decision on this one fact:, May 5, 2006
This movie is a one-shot tie-in to the old-school side-scrolling X-Men arcade beat-'em-up. It is only loosely tied to the comics, it's not meant to literally match any particular series or incarnation of the team.

[This explains all the discrepancies that other reviewers are complaining about.]

The arcade game was my all-time favorite (especially the 6-player extra-large cabinet) and I love this movie just as much. Both have a cheesy 80's polish that make them irresistable.
